Blackjack The Blackjack class begins with the rules and object of the game, the student is then advanced to equipment and dealer and player positions. The proper handling of cheques and the proper distribution of the cards, as they pertain to the game of blackjack, are given considerable attention. Through hands-on training the student will master the skill of dealing from a single deck, double deck and delivery from a shoe. Multi-hand procedures, splitting pairs, doubling down, black jack and insurance are also taught in detail.
